Purpose – The objective of this article is to highlight the important role played by an entrepreneur’s network in the survival and performance of new ventures. Design/methodology/approach – The article is based on a case study of a new venture, where data were collected from various stakeholders through interviews. Findings – Entrepreneurs can overcome their liability of newness, enhance their competitiveness and increase their firm’s value by utilizing their networks. The case study demonstrated in the study is a good example of how an entrepreneur utilized his strong ties and weak ties to establish and enhance the performance of his venture. Practical implications – The findings can be utilized by entrepreneurs worldwide to reduce the mortality rate of their venture and enhance their performance. Originality/value – The article demonstrates, through a case study, a unique business model of an entrepreneurial venture that leverages the power of networks to achieve superior performance.
